Overstimulation is an invisible epidemic in our world–and it is impacting you and your child more than you realize.
If you’ve felt overwhelmed and burnt out by the exhaustion of daily life, flattened by the sheer amount of noise and distraction in your home, your schedule, your brain you aren’t alone.
What’s more, overstimulation is a key driver of our children’s behaviors, contributing to increased symptoms in anxiety, depression, and attentional diagnoses. In the fast-paced culture of our world, is it possible to set our children up to thrive in emotional health?
Sarah Boyd (M.Ed Psych), child and adolescent development expert and founder of the educational company Resilient Little Hearts, believes it is possible to turn down the noise of overstimulation and chronic stress for you and your family. In her new book, she gives you the psychological frameworks and simple practical tools to turn down the noise of overstimulation and stress, so that you can cultivate emotional health for your child and family.
Turn Down the Noise provides the strategies and tools to simplify your family life, including:
*The neuroscience of children’s emotions, and why your brain leads you to often over-react in the hard parenting moments (& what to do instead)
*How to identify and navigate the trait of high sensitivity in yourself or your child
*A new way of approaching our growth as parents towards emotional maturity (without any perfectionism or guilt)
*Practical ways to reduce the pace of family life to prioritize connection, creative play and life-giving routines without sacrificing your most important values and responsibilities.
*How to cultivate healthy boundaries to navigate media and the online world to protect our souls from the invisible stressors of the modern environment
*Facilitate a deeper connection with your child or adolescent through their most formative years, laying a foundation for their future resilience & emotional health.
This book is an essential, empathetic guide to creating an environment for our children (& teens) to thrive. We cannot change the world we are all living in – but we do have influence over the environment our children experience in our relationships, homes, and classrooms. It is possible to turn down the noise.

Life Lessons From James
$14.99Do your Monday actions reflect your Sunday worship? How about your claims to faith? Is your life full of noticeable changes and actions? James, the half-brother of Jesus, wasn’t impressed with talk. He knew that a life of faith was all about actions that revealed a difference in a person’s life. For him, it was not that works save the Christian, but that they mark the Christian. In his letter, he boldly deals with practical issues of faith not bound by culture or place. He shows the importance of living a genuine life of faith. His message is bare-knuckled as he encourages, challenges, and confronts, offering practical words and admonitions to live out our faith.
The Life Lessons with Max Lucado series brings the Bible to life in twelve lessons filled with intriguing questions, inspirational stories, and poignant reflections to take you deeper into God’s Word. Each lesson includes an opening reflection, background information, an excerpt of the text (from the New International and New King James versions), exploration questions, inspirational thoughts from Max, and a closing takeaway for further reflection. The Life Lessons series is ideal for use in both a small-group setting or for individual study.

Screwtape Letters
$14.99Wormwood, a demon apprentice, must secure the damnation of a young man who’s just become a Christian. He seeks the advice of an experienced devil, his uncle Screwtape. Their correspondence offers invaluable—and often humorous—insights on temptation, pride, and the ultimate victory of faith over evil forces. Paperback with French flaps and deckled page edges.
